The Virgin Islands Election Form for Continuation of Benefits (COBRA) is an important document that allows individuals in the Virgin Islands to exercise their right to continue receiving certain benefits after an event that would otherwise cause them to lose coverage. COBRA refers to the Consolidated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act, which mandated this coverage continuation option. This form is specifically designed for residents of the U.S. Virgin Islands who are eligible for COBRA benefits, allowing them to elect the continuation of various health, dental, and vision insurance plans, among others. By completing this form, individuals can ensure that they maintain their coverage, even if they would otherwise lose it due to certain qualifying events such as termination of employment, divorce, or a dependent's loss of eligibility. The Virgin Islands Election Form for Continuation of Benefits — COBRA typically requires the following information: employee's name, contact details, and social security number; the name and contact information of the employer; a list of beneficiaries (including dependents); the date of the qualifying event; and the type of coverage the individual wishes to continue.
